🇫🇷🆚🇧🇷 What a thrilling group stage match! France emerged victorious with a hard-fought 2-1 win against Brazil. ⚽️🔥

Eugenie Le Sommer set the tone early on, opening the scoring for France in the 17th minute with a brilliant finish! 🎯👏

However, Brazil wasn’t ready to back down. Debora Cristiane de Oliveira showed her class and determination, equalizing the score in the 58th minute! 🙌🇧🇷

As the clock ticked down, tension built up, and it was the inevitable Wendie Renard who stole the show for France in the 83rd minute! 💪⚽️ Her late goal turned out to be the match-winner, sealing an essential victory for Les Bleues! 🎉🥳
